James J. Heckman won the Nobel Prize in Economic Sciences in 2000 for his development of methods for analyzing selective samples. He shared the prize with Daniel McFadden.

Who was awarded the Nobel Prize for the discovery of neutrons?

James Chadwick was awarded the Nobel Prize in Physics in 1935 for his discovery of the neutron. The neutron is a subatomic particle found in the nucleus of an atom and it has no electric charge.
